MCP Server for ArangoDB

[](./assets/cover.webp)

A Model Context Protocol server for ArangoDB

This is a TypeScript-based MCP server that provides database interaction capabilities through ArangoDB. It implements core database operations and allows seamless integration with ArangoDB through MCP tools. You can use it wih Claude app and also extension for VSCode that works with mcp like Cline!

Features

Tools

ToolCategoryRead-onlyMutates data/schemaPurpose
`arango_query`QueryNoMaybeExecute general AQL with bind variables, bounded results, and query guardrails.
`arango_read_query`QueryYesNoExecute read-only AQL and reject write/DDL keywords.
`arango_validate_query`QueryYesNoParse and validate AQL without executing it.
`arango_explain_query`QueryYesNoInspect AQL execution plans, index usage, and optimizer output.
`arango_describe_database`DiscoveryYesNoSummarize collections, counts, indexes, and sample fields.
`arango_list_collections`DiscoveryYesNoList collections in the configured database.
`arango_get_collection`DiscoveryYesNoReturn collection properties, count, and indexes.
`arango_create_collection`CollectionNoYesCreate document or edge collections.
`arango_drop_collection`CollectionNoYesDrop a collection, requiring `confirm: true`.
`arango_get_document`DocumentYesNoFetch one document by collection and `_key`.
`arango_list_documents`DocumentYesNoList documents with `limit` and `offset` pagination.
`arango_count_documents`DocumentYesNoCount documents in a collection.
`arango_sample_documents`DocumentYesNoReturn a small random sample for schema discovery.
`arango_insert`DocumentNoYesInsert one document into a collection.
`arango_bulk_insert`DocumentNoYesInsert up to 1000 documents in one request.
`arango_update`DocumentNoYesPartially update one document by `_key`.
`arango_bulk_update`DocumentNoYesPatch up to 1000 documents by `_key` or `_id`.
`arango_remove`DocumentNoYesRemove one document by `_key`.
`arango_list_indexes`IndexYesNoList indexes for a collection.
`arango_create_index`IndexNoYesCreate persistent, geo, TTL, or inverted indexes.
`arango_list_views`ArangoSearchYesNoList ArangoSearch and search-alias Views.
`arango_create_search_view`ArangoSearchNoYesCreate an ArangoSearch View linked to a collection.
`arango_search`ArangoSearchYesNoSearch an ArangoSearch View with analyzer-aware BM25 ranking.
`arango_list_analyzers`AnalyzerYesNoList ArangoSearch Analyzers.
`arango_create_analyzer`AnalyzerNoYesCreate an ArangoSearch Analyzer.
`arango_list_graphs`GraphYesNoList named graphs.
`arango_create_graph`GraphNoYesCreate a named graph with one edge definition.
`arango_insert_edge`GraphNoYesInsert an edge document with `_from` and `_to`.
`arango_traverse`GraphYesNoTraverse edges from a start vertex using an edge collection or named graph.
`arango_shortest_path`GraphYesNoFind the shortest path between two vertices using an edge collection or named graph.
`arango_backup`BackupNoFilesystemBackup collections to JSON files under `ARANGO_BACKUP_ROOT`.

All tools return JSON text and `structuredContent` when successful. Read-heavy tools expose bounded `limit` parameters to keep responses agent-friendly. Query tools also support guardrails such as `memoryLimit`, `maxRuntime`, and `failOnWarning` where applicable.

        Environment Variables

        The server requires the following environment variables:

        • `ARANGO_URL` - ArangoDB server URL (note: 8529 is the default port for ArangoDB for local development)
        • `ARANGO_DB` - Database name
        • `ARANGO_USERNAME` - Database user
        • `ARANGO_PASSWORD` - Database password
        • `ARANGO_BACKUP_ROOT` - Optional root directory for `arango_backup` output. Defaults to `./backups`.

        Backup database collections:

        typescript
        {
          "outputDir": "nightly_1", // Safe subdirectory name under ARANGO_BACKUP_ROOT. Absolute paths and slashes are rejected.
          "collection": "users", // Optional. If omitted, all collections are backed up.
          "docLimit": 1000 // Optional. Maximum documents per collection. Defaults to 1000 and is capped at 10000.
        }

        Set `ARANGO_BACKUP_ROOT` to choose where backups are stored. The server rejects path traversal, absolute paths, symlink escapes, and existing output files to mitigate arbitrary file write risks.

        Disclaimer

        For Development Use Only

        This tool is designed for local development environments only. While technically it could connect to a production database, this would create significant security risks and is explicitly discouraged. We use it exclusively with our development databases to maintain separation of concerns and protect production data.

        Testing

        bash
        npm test

        The test suite includes regression coverage for the `arango_backup` path handling that prevents absolute paths, traversal, and symlink escapes.

        To run the integration smoke test with a local Docker ArangoDB instance:

        bash
        npm run test:integration

        The integration test starts a temporary Docker ArangoDB instance, starts the MCP server over stdio, lists tools, verifies `outputSchema`, creates a temporary collection, inserts documents, queries with `limit`, verifies backup output stays under `ARANGO_BACKUP_ROOT`, rejects an absolute backup path, cleans up the collection, and stops the container.

        The test container uses host port `18529` by default to avoid conflicting with a local ArangoDB on `8529`. Override it with `ARANGO_PORT` if needed.
